Transaction 59dcf9f585cb7e82760604492b942fe36df75b72594ccf3bb6b52a56b3269f75

2 Input
2 Outputs
  • 59dcf9f585cb7e82760604492b942fe36df75b72594ccf3bb6b52a56b3269f75:0
  • value  1001169
    address  16i9C5EQAHKHkegf4W9ozW4CryNrqysnfS
  • 59dcf9f585cb7e82760604492b942fe36df75b72594ccf3bb6b52a56b3269f75:1
  • value  79058450
    address  18PCS2N91SaKsNZVsfSs7b8B1hj6dHwJXu